Keep reading to find out how it went...! :) YES you read that correctly! For months I've been searching (rather half-arsed-ly might I add) for vegan protein powder here in Tokyo. I have asked around and most people have replied saying they just buy theirs online every few weeks but I don't really like to shop online too much and I wanted to physically see the stuff before i bought it so i held off from using my Amazon Prime for this. Thankfully i found some SOY PROTEIN powder (the brand name is ZAVAS) in a pharmacy in Tokyo and have since actually found similar brands in other pharmacies and chemists near the diet foods section. The pack is about 1.5kg, cost about 4000 JPY and is chocolate flavored which is great because i have really been craving chocolate lately... :') The pack comes with a serving spoon and each serving contains 15g of protein so its great for those who are looking to add more protein to their diet for any reason. Its also not a meal-replacement mixture so is low in sugar. Personally I plan to use this to build a bit more muscle. I workout pretty often but i am out of the house for 10 hours a day so find it difficult to get the necessary protein to keep my body fueled.
